How they compare
Pakistan currently reports 3.5 against 2.86 in Costa Rica, a difference of 0.64.
That makes Pakistan's figure about 1.2 times Costa Rica's.
Across all 9 years both countries report, Pakistan has been ahead every year.
Costa Rica ranks 6th and Pakistan ranks 4th of 28 countries.
Pakistan has averaged higher in every one of the 3 decades both report.
